From 69d4e71309c64573b508c936f96ace3b1d016a59 Mon Sep 17 00:00:00 2001 From: Terry Wilson Date: Thu, 26 May 2022 17:03:14 -0700 Subject: [PATCH] Enable xDS custom LB config by default. (#9214) --- xds/src/main/java/io/grpc/xds/ClientXdsClient.java | 6 ++---- .../io/grpc/xds/FakeControlPlaneXdsIntegrationTest.java | 1 - 2 files changed, 2 insertions(+), 5 deletions(-) diff --git a/xds/src/main/java/io/grpc/xds/ClientXdsClient.java b/xds/src/main/java/io/grpc/xds/ClientXdsClient.java index 18888eb56f6..92161b0a984 100644 --- a/xds/src/main/java/io/grpc/xds/ClientXdsClient.java +++ b/xds/src/main/java/io/grpc/xds/ClientXdsClient.java @@ -164,10 +164,8 @@ final class ClientXdsClient extends XdsClient implements XdsResponseHandler, Res : Boolean.parseBoolean(System.getProperty("io.grpc.xds.experimentalEnableLeastRequest")); @VisibleForTesting static boolean enableCustomLbConfig = - !Strings.isNullOrEmpty(System.getenv("GRPC_EXPERIMENTAL_XDS_CUSTOM_LB_CONFIG")) - ? Boolean.parseBoolean(System.getenv("GRPC_EXPERIMENTAL_XDS_CUSTOM_LB_CONFIG")) - : Boolean.parseBoolean( - System.getProperty("io.grpc.xds.experimentalEnableCustomLbConfig")); + Strings.isNullOrEmpty(System.getenv("GRPC_EXPERIMENTAL_XDS_CUSTOM_LB_CONFIG")) + || Boolean.parseBoolean(System.getenv("GRPC_EXPERIMENTAL_XDS_CUSTOM_LB_CONFIG")); private static final String TYPE_URL_HTTP_CONNECTION_MANAGER_V2 = "type.googleapis.com/envoy.config.filter.network.http_connection_manager.v2" + ".HttpConnectionManager"; diff --git a/xds/src/test/java/io/grpc/xds/FakeControlPlaneXdsIntegrationTest.java b/xds/src/test/java/io/grpc/xds/FakeControlPlaneXdsIntegrationTest.java index 16916b31563..dfe4fb4953f 100644 --- a/xds/src/test/java/io/grpc/xds/FakeControlPlaneXdsIntegrationTest.java +++ b/xds/src/test/java/io/grpc/xds/FakeControlPlaneXdsIntegrationTest.java @@ -158,7 +158,6 @@ public class FakeControlPlaneXdsIntegrationTest { */ @Before public void setUp() throws Exception { - ClientXdsClient.enableCustomLbConfig = true; startControlPlane(); nameResolverProvider = XdsNameResolverProvider.createForTest(SCHEME, defaultBootstrapOverride());